Abstract:
The ligand 1,3-di (1H- imidazol-1-y)1-2-propanol (DIPO) is a modified form of Diimidazolopropane (DIP) whose complexes with copper (II) and cobalt (II) have been prepared. The characterization of ligand as well as that of complexes has been done through mass, conductance, magnetic moments, NMR, IR, and UV/visible measurements and elemental analysis. These measurements indicate that DIPO enforces tetrahedral structure to the complexes of cobalt (II) and copper (II). TGA and DTA have also been carried out.
